Watermelon Lemonade
What says "summer" more than watermelon and lemonade? This recipe uses local honey instead of cane sugar, making it a healthier option for your whole family. Equipment
- Blender or Food Processor
Ingredients
- 1½ lbs watermelon* cubed
- 1 cup fresh-squeezed lemon juice
- ½ cup honey*
- 6 cups water
- herbs* mint, basil, thyme, etc
- 1 pint frozen berries* and/or ice
Instructions
- Add the watermelon, lemon juice, honey and 2 cups of water to a blender. Blend until smooth. Pour into a large pitcher and add remaining water. Stir.
- Add more honey to taste. Add in a sprig of herbs if desired. When serving use frozen berries or frozen chunks of fruit to keep lemonade chilled without watering down the flavor!
